Common to these sizes is a 64-degree head angle; 78-degree seat angle (effective, at max extension); 430mm chainstays and 80mm bottom bracket drop. 3 sizes: 653|460, 653|480, 661|500, stack|reach. The Squatch is designed around and shipped with a short 42mm offset fork which brings us closer to the steering axis therefore generating a greater trail measurement, which when complimented with a 35mm or shorter stem makes for steering thats more sensitive to micro adjustments as well as being more stable at higher speeds. The Squatch hails from Yorkshire-based bike shop Stif and is an evolution of its hard-hitting, 650b-wheeled Morf hardtail. Connecting the drive side chainstay to the bottom bracket is their unique 12 bore bridge which not only looks interesting, but also allows for impressive tire clearance for the fitment of chunky 2.6 rubber and a 34t chainring with the compact 430mm rear end. Sitting 80mm below the axles, the bottom bracket (BB) is slammed to keep your centre of gravity low. With a 420mm seat tube, the medium frame should work for some shorter riders, though it certainly won't fit everyone. The geometry is at no point the element holding you back, but the limited ability to iron out the square edges of the terrain leads to an incredibly physical ride where your arms and legs must work hard to absorb impacts that you do not even consider on a fully suspended rig.
